How much do 3rd shift clerical j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for 3rd shift clerical in the United States is $19.02,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.35 and $21.39 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a 3rd shift clerical?

To thrive as a 3rd Shift Clerical,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and basic office knowledge,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with office software like Microsoft Office Suite and data entry systems is typically required. Excellent time management, reliability, and the ability to work independently during overnight hours are valuable soft skills. These competencies ensure accurate record-keeping, efficient workflow, and smooth operations during non-standard business hours.

What are some unique challenges of working as a 3rd shift clerical, and how can I prepare for them?

Working as a 3rd Shift Clerical employee often involves adjusting to overnight hours, which can affect sleep patterns and social life. You'll need to be self-motivated and able to maintain accuracy and focus during quieter, off-peak times. Communication with daytime teams is essential, so proficiency in written updates and handover notes is valuable. To excel, consider establishing a consistent sleep schedule, using tools for effective handoffs, and practicing self-care to maintain alertness and productivity.

What is a 3rd shift clerical?

3rd Shift Clerical jobs involve performing administrative and office tasks during the overnight hours, typically between 11:00 PM and 7:00 AM. Duties may include data entry, filing, managing correspondence, processing paperwork, and supporting other departments as needed. These roles are essential in industries that operate around the clock, such as healthcare, logistics, and manufacturing, to ensure smooth operations and timely completion of tasks. Working the 3rd shift often requires adaptability to nighttime hours and strong organizational skills.

Do 3rd shift clerical jobs pay more?

3rd shift clerical jobs often pay slightly higher wages compared to day shifts due to the inconvenience of working overnight hours. However, pay rates vary by employer, location, and experience, and shift differentials are not guaranteed for all positions. Factors such as overtime opportunities and benefits can also influence overall compensation.

CTDI is a large-scale Engineering, Repair, and Logistics company that services the country's largest wireless telecommunications providers, as well as the largest High-speed Internet & Cable providers. CTDI has over 11,000 FT US Employees in over 60 world class US Operations. CTDI also has a global footprint with more than 20,000 employees worldwide.
A Material Handler performs manual and clerical duties related to shipping, receiving, inspecting, storing, issuing and delivering a variety of materials, equipment and supplies.
3rd Shift: 11:30PM - 8:00AM, Monday - Friday
Pay Rate: $16.94/hour + 10% Shift Differential = $18.63/hour
Duties and Responsibilities
  • Executes foundational tasks within a warehouse environment including but not limited to: packaging, unpackaging, put away, sorting, staging, picking, shipping and preparing units for production.
  • Cut open boxed inventory in the storage area or on the rack.
  • Place open boxes on the appropriate shelf of the flow rack.
  • Walk the length of the flow rack.
  • Wrap cords neatly and securely, ensuring they are tangle-free.
  • Assist with labeling, tagging, or color-coding wrapped cords as needed for easy identification.
  • Consistently meet or surpass daily production and quality goals.
  • Complete required paperwork, forms, or digital records accurately and promptly for documentation purposes.
  • Maintain a clean, organized workstation.
  • Responsible for following warehouse safety regulations.
  • All other duties assigned, based on the business the warehouse supports.

Required Skills and Experience
  • Capacity to demonstrate reliability, adaptability, and dependability.
  • Attention to detail, accuracy, and organizational skills.
  • Ability to work independently and in a team environment.
  • Basic computer ability.
  • Ability to understand and follow directions.

Preferred Skills and Experience
  • Previous experience working in a high-volume distribution, manufacturing, technical service (i.e. testing and repair) or forward logistics operation a plus.
  • Handles basic issues and problems and refers more complex issues to higher-level staff.
  • Clerical skills.
  • Time-management skills.
  • Written and verbal communication skills.

Educational Requirements
  • High school diploma or equivalent work experience.

Physical Demands and Working Conditions
  • Warehouse environment.
  • Stand dynamically for long periods.
  • Use hands and fingers to handle and/or feel; the ability to type, pick, pinch with fingers, seize, hold, grasp or turn with hands.
  • Lift up to fifty (50) pounds.
  • Push and/or pull up to fifty (50) pounds.
  • Reach up and out with hands and arms
  • Occasionally required to climb stairs or ladders.
